Pinpoint Test I: The Left Or Right Exterior Mirror Blind Spot Information System (BLIS(TM))/Cross Traffic Alert (CTA) LED Appears Dim Or Does Not Illuminate With No DTC Or Message In The Instrument Panel Cluster (IPC) Message Center Present


Refer to Wiring Diagrams Set 136, Vehicle Emergency Messaging System for schematic and connector information.



Normal Operation


For the Blind Spot Information System (BLIS(TM)), the exterior mirror BLIS(TM)/Cross Traffic Alert (CTA) LED is at 95 percent illumination to be seen clearly during the day and is dimmed down to 10 percent at night. For the CTA system, the exterior mirror BLIS(TM)/CTA LED is always at 85 percent illumination.

This pinpoint test is intended to diagnose the following:

- Wiring, terminals or connectors
- Side Obstacle Detection Control Module - Right (SOD-R)
- Side Obstacle Detection Control Module - Left (SOD-L)
- Exterior mirror BLIS(TM)/ CTA LED


PINPOINT TEST I: THE LEFT OR RIGHT EXTERIOR MIRROR BLIS(TM)/CTA LED APPEARS DIM OR DOES NOT ILLUMINATE WITH NO DTC OR MESSAGE IN THE IPC MESSAGE CENTER PRESENT


NOTICE: Use the correct probe adapter(s) when making measurements. Failure to use the correct probe adapter(s) may damage the connector.

NOTE: Failure to disconnect the battery when instructed will result in false resistance readings. Refer to Battery, Mounting and Cables [1][2]Battery.

I1 VERIFY THE CUSTOMER'S CONCERN


- Carry out the diagnostic system check.
- Start the engine.
- Observe the left and right exterior mirror BLIS(TM)/ CTA LEDs and compare the illumination in each mirror.
- Is one LED noticeably dimmer than the other?

Yes
GO to I2.

No
The concern may be due to customer perception or ambient lighting conditions. TEST the system for normal operation.

-------------------------------------------------
I2 VERIFY THE EXTERIOR MIRROR BLIS(TM)/CTA LED OPERATION


- Ignition OFF.
- Apply the park brake.
- Ignition ON.
- Select REVERSE.
- Enter the following diagnostic mode on the scan tool: SOD-R and/or SOD-L DataLogger .
- NOTE: The SOD-R and SOD-L are separate modules and the active command PID needs to be commanded on in each individual module.
- Select the SOD-R or SOD-L PID (CTALERT) and active command the LED ON.
- Observe the left and/or right exterior mirror BLIS(TM)/ CTA LED and message center.
- Does the LED blink brightly and a message in the message center display "CTA ALERT"?

Yes
The concern may be due to customer perception, ambient lighting conditions or system functionality. TEST the system for normal operation.

No
GO to I3.

-------------------------------------------------
I3 CHECK THE SOD-R OR SOD-L VOLTAGE SUPPLY CIRCUIT


- Ignition OFF.
- Disconnect: SOD-L C4230 (LH concern) .
- Disconnect: SOD-R C4229 (RH concern) .
- Ignition ON.
- For a LH concern, measure the voltage between the SOD-L C4230-2, circuit CBP35 (YE/GY), harness side and ground.
- For a RH concern, measure the voltage between the SOD-R C4229-2, circuit CBP35 (YE/GY), harness side and ground.






- Is the voltage greater than 10 volts?

Yes
GO to I4.

No
REPAIR the circuit. TEST the system for normal operation.

-------------------------------------------------
I4 CHECK THE SOD-R OR SOD-L GROUND CIRCUIT FOR AN OPEN


- Ignition OFF.
- Disconnect: Negative Battery Cable .
- For a LH concern, measure the resistance between the SOD-L C4230-5, circuit GD133 (BK), harness side and ground.
- For a RH concern, measure the resistance between the SOD-R C4229-5, circuit GD145 (BK/BU), harness side and ground.






- Is the resistance less that 5 ohms?

Yes
GO to I5.

No
REPAIR the circuit. TEST the system for normal operation.

-------------------------------------------------
I5 CHECK THE SUSPECTED EXTERIOR MIRROR BLIS(TM)/CTA LED FOR ILLUMINATION


- Connect: Negative Battery Cable .
- Ignition OFF.
- For a LH concern, connect a fused jumper wire between the SOD-L C4230-2, circuit CBP35 (YE/GY), harness side and the SOD-L C4230-1, circuit CRB04 (YE/GN), harness side.
- For a RH concern, connect a fused jumper wire between the SOD-R C4229-2, circuit CBP35 (YE/GY), harness side and the SOD-R C4229-1, circuit CRB02 (BU/BN), harness side.






- Ignition ON.
- Does the LED appear dim?

Yes
GO to I6.

No
For a LH concern, INSTALL a new SOD-L. REFER to Side Obstacle Detection (SOD) Module Service and Repair . TEST the system for normal operation.

For a RH concern, INSTALL a new SOD-R. REFER to Side Obstacle Detection (SOD) Module Service and Repair . TEST the system for normal operation.

-------------------------------------------------
I6 CHECK THE SUSPECTED EXTERIOR MIRROR BLIS(TM)/CTA LED CIRCUITS FOR AN OPEN


- Ignition OFF.
- Disconnect: Left Exterior Mirror BLIS(TM)/ CTA LED C576 (LH concern) .
- Disconnect: Right Exterior Mirror BLIS(TM)/ CTA LED C676 (RH concern) .
- Ignition ON.
- For a LH concern, measure the voltage between the left exterior mirror BLIS(TM)/ CTA LED C576-1, harness side and the left exterior mirror BLIS(TM)/ CTA LED C576-2, harness side.
- For a RH concern, measure the voltage between the right exterior mirror BLIS(TM)/ CTA LED C676-1, harness side and the right exterior mirror BLIS(TM)/ CTA LED C676-2, harness side.






- Is the voltage greater than 10 volts?

Yes
INSTALL a new exterior mirror glass for the one in question. REFER to Rear View Mirrors Description and Operation. TEST the system for normal operation.

No
GO to I7.

-------------------------------------------------
I7 CHECK THE SUSPECTED EXTERIOR MIRROR BLIS(TM)/CTA LED VOLTAGE SUPPLY CIRCUIT FOR AN OPEN


- Ignition OFF.
- For a LH concern, measure the resistance between the SOD-L C4230-1, circuit CRB04 (YE/GN), harness side and left exterior mirror BLIS(TM)/ CTA LEDC576-1, harness side.
- For a RH concern, measure the resistance between the SOD-R C4229-1, circuit CRB02 (BU/BN), harness side and the right exterior mirror BLIS(TM)/ CTA LED C676-1, harness side.






- Is the resistance less than 5 ohms?

Yes
For a LH concern, REPAIR circuit GD133 (BK) for an open. TEST the system for normal operation.

For a RH concern, REPAIR circuit GD145 (BK/BU) for an open. TEST the system for normal operation.

No
For a LH concern, REPAIR circuit CRB04 (YE/GN) for an open. TEST the system for normal operation.

For a RH concern, REPAIR circuit CRB02 (BU/BN) for an open. TEST the system for normal operation.
